Web10 de nov. de 2024 · If you want to increase your credit score, though, you need to spend less than 30% of your spending limit. Only use $20 … WebHow fast can you go from 500 to 700 credit score? Depending on how well you utilize your credit, your credit score may get to anywhere from 500 to 700 within the first six months. Going forward, getting to an excellent credit score of over 800 generally takes years since the average age of credit factors into your score.
